Paige Leskin, a reporter at Insider who covered the tech industry, has left the news organization.
Leskin covered social media platforms, internet culture, and anything weird on the world wide web.
She writes about social media, influencers and personalities, companies like Instagram and TikTok, and trends taking over the internet. She’s covered content moderation on YouTube, controversies around big names like Elizabeth Holmes and Caroline Calloway, and explainers on using the newest features for your favorite apps.
Leskin had been at Insider since September 2018. She is a graduation of Northwestern University.
